How to Make Broccoli Stuffed Chicken Breast
Quick Overview
This recipe is designed to be both easy and satisfying. With minimal prep and just a handful of ingredients, you can create a meal that’s packed with flavor. Perfect for busy weeknights or special occasions, this stuffed chicken breast is sure to become a family favorite.
Key Ingredients
- 4 large bo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 2 cups chopped broccoli florets
- 1/2 cup cooked Arborio rice or quinoa
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ise
- 1/4 cup breadcrumbs
- 1 egg
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Prepare the Broccoli Mixture
Steam the broccoli florets until tender. In a bowl, combine the steamed broccoli, rice or quinoa, Parmesan cheese, mayonnaise, breadcrumbs, and egg. Mix well and season with salt and pepper. - Stuff the Chicken Breasts
Cut a horizontal slit in each chicken breast to create a pocket. Fill each pocket with the broccoli mixture. - Cook on Stovetop or Grill
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Place the stuffed chicken breasts in the skillet, seam side down. Cook for 6-8 minutes on each side, or until the chicken is fully cooked and the stuffing is heated through. - Serve Warm
Garnish with fresh herbs if desired. Serve immediately and enjoy!

Top Tips for Perfecting Broccoli Stuffed Chicken Breast
- Stuffing Tips: Ensure the stuffing is well-seasoned and not too wet to maintain a crispy exterior.
- Cooking Time: Adjust cooking time based on the thickness of your chicken breasts to avoid overcooking.
- Variations: Try adding different cheeses or herbs for a unique flavor profile.
Storing and Reheating Tips
- Storage: Let the dish cool slightly before refrigerating. It will stay fresh for up to 3 days.
- Reheating: Reheat in the microwave or oven until warmed through for optimal taste.
